In this thesis, an animal nicknamed Qorako`z Majnun, an animal depicted in the story "Qorako`z Majnun" written by the Uzbek writer Said Ahmad, known for his works of deep observation, is shown as an example to the human race with its devotion to its owner. described as a symbol of loyalty. At the beginning of the story, a hadith from the hadith is quoted as an epigraph: "One of the ten animals that will enter Paradise is the 'loyal dog of the Companions of the Cave.'
